Wastewater treatment filling material and preparation method thereof

The invention provides a wastewater treatment filling material and a preparation method thereof. The wastewater treatment filling material comprises the following component raw materials by weight percent: 20-70% of iron powder, 2-15% of copper powder, 3-10% of bamboo charcoal powder, 2-15% of kaolin, 2-15% of magnesite powder and 10%-30% of zeolite powder. The preparation method comprises the following steps: respectively smashing and carrying out ball-milling on the component raw materials; then mixing and granulating to form a granular mixture; and finally, preparing a granular filling material by high-temperature sintering or cold pressing. Compared with the prior art, the wastewater treatment filling material prepared by the method provided by the invention has the characteristics that reaction rate is high, wastewater treatment time only needs from several minutes to tens of minutes; treatment amount is large; coagulation effect is good, COD (chemical oxygen demand) removal rateis high, and removal of chroma is better; service life is long, and cost is low; the range of acting on organic pollutants is wide; and operation and management are convenient, and passivation, channeling and wastes are not generated.

Artificial wetland-microbial fuel cell coupling device with multi-medium filter material and wastewater treatment method by using device

The invention discloses an artificial wetland-microbial fuel cell coupling device with a multi-medium filter material and a wastewater treatment method by using the device, and belongs to the technical field of sewage treatment and electrochemical coupling. The artificial wetland substrate is prepared by the multi-medium filter material, and coconut shell activated carbon and stainless steel netsare used as an anode and a cathode. Emergent aquatic plants are planted, and aeration pipe are arranged. The device comprises a sieve plate, a zeolite zone, an anode zone, a ceramsite zone and a cathode zone from bottom to top; the anode zone and the cathode zone are both laid by the stainless steel meshes and are connected through an external circuit; an outer resistance is arranged between the anode and the cathode; an outflow water collecting zone and an inflow water distribution zone are respectively arranged at the upper part and the lower part, and the outflow water collecting zone and the inflow water distribution zone are respectively connected with a water supply system and a drainage system; a water inlet tank is connected with the bottom of the device; and a water outlet is formed in the upper part of the device. According to the system, the coupling effect of artificial wetland and a microbial fuel cell is fully exerted, and the multi-medium filter material is utilized, sothat the denitrification effect is enhanced, electricity generation performance is improved, and recycling of resources is realized.

Forsterite bio-filter material for sewage treatment and preparation method of forsterite bio-filter material

The invention particularly relates to a forsterite bio-filter material for sewage treatment and a preparation method of the forsterite bio-filter material. The technical scheme is as follows: the preparation method comprises the following step: uniformly mixing 45-55wt% of forsterite raw ore fine powder, 20-30wt% of talc fine powder, 15-25wt% of magnesium oxide fine powder and 2-6wt% of dravite micropowder as raw materials with additional 2-6wt% of starch to prepare a mixed material; then, putting the mixed material and polystyrene balls in a pelletizer in a volume ratio of the polystyrene balls and the mixed material of (1.5-2.0) to 1; then, adding 10-20wt% of water to prepare particles with the grain size being 5-13mm; and then, roasting the prepared particles for 16-24 hours at 110-150 DEG C, and sintering for 2-4 hours at 1300-1500 DEG C to prepare the forsterite bio-filter material for sewage treatment. The forsterite bio-filter material for sewage treatment is simple in process and wide in source of raw materials and the prepared forsterite bio-filter material for sewage treatment has the characteristics of good flora biofilm culturing effect, high flora survival rate, good decoloring effect and high strength.

Preparation method of modified polyurethane sponge filler for emergency of MBBR process

The invention relates to a preparation method of modified polyurethane sponge filler for emergency of an MBBR (Moving Bed Biofilm Reactor) process. The preparation method is characterized by comprising the following specific steps: soaking a sponge filler into an acidic potassium permanganate mixed solution; taking out the sponge filler, soaking the taken sponge filler into a hydrochloric acid solution until a brown layer on the surface is washed away, taking out the sponge filler, and performing draining; putting the sponge filler into PBS for soaking, taking out the sponge filler after the solution is neutral, and naturally airing the sponge filler; soaking the air-dried sponge filler into a modifier, taking out the sponge filler, and performing draining; soaking the sponge filler into agelatin protein solution containing diatomite and powdered activated carbon; and taking out the sponge filler, performing washing, and performing natural airing to obtain the modified sponge filler used for sewage treatment. The method has the beneficial effects that through the synergistic mechanism of the adsorption effects of activated carbon and the diatomite attached to the surface of the sponge filler and the oxygenolysis effect of microorganisms, the biofilm culturing speed can be increased, meanwhile, the degradation performance of the sponge filler on pollutants in sewage is effectively improved, and therefore the sewage treatment effect is improved.

Layered water landscape bank protection system

The invention relates to water conservancy bank protection buildings, in particular to a layered water landscape bank protection system. The layered water landscape bank protection system can integrate watercourse protection, river aquatic animal parasitism and plant landscape. The system is formed by staggered arrangement of a kind of concrete blocks layer by layer, namely blocks are arranged in parallel on the bottom layer of a watercourse along a river bank firstly, then blocks are piled on the bottom blocks in a staggered mode, adjacent layers of blocks are fixed with connecting rods, the rest is done in the same way till the blocks are piled on the top of the bank, and then the layered water landscape bank protection system is formed. A cylindrical gallery on the blocks can be filled with pebbles under the water surface to serve as a gallery for living of small aquatic animals, planting soil can be arranged above the water surface for green planting, and a fan-shaped gap between every two adjacent blocks can serve as a planting groove which is filled with planting soil for planting of aquatic plants. The layered water landscape bank protection system can protect and green the river bank, enables tourists to be close to the water surface, and plays an important role in creating watercourse landscape.

Lower water-inlet, lower aeration and upper water-outlet biological active carbon filter tank

The invention relates to a lower water-inlet, lower aeration and upper water-outlet biological active carbon filter tank. The biological active carbon filter tank comprises a tank body, a biological active carbon material-filtering layer, a water distribution device, a filtering head, a supporting plate, an air distribution device and a purified water catching groove, wherein the water distribution device, the filtering head, the supporting plate, the air distribution device and the biological active carbon material-filtering layer are arranged in the tank body sequentially from the bottom to the top; and a water distribution inlet of the water distribution device and an air inlet of the air distribution device are both extended out of the tank body. The lower water-inlet, lower aeration and upper water-outlet biological active carbon filter tank has the advantages that: a lower water-inlet, lower aeration and upper water-outlet mode is adopted, and water and air flow towards the same direction and rise in a plug-flow mode, so that the resistance of a filter material to water is reduced and the filtering speed of sewage can be maintained stably and uniformly; simultaneously, the upward impact force applied to the filter material is increased, so that the filter material is in a swollen state; at the moment, the filter material is fully mixed with water and air so as to improve the membrane-filtering effect of the filter material; and the filter material is in the swollen state and is difficult to harden, so that the flushing frequency of the filter tank is reduced.

Method for promoting biofilm culturing effect by modifying surface of polyurethane

The invention discloses a method for promoting a biofilm culturing effect by modifying the surface of polyurethane. According to the method, polyurethane is used as a template material in a layer-by-layer self-assembly process; iron and manganese ions cover the surface of the material through pretreatment of an iron-manganese salt solution, so that the surface of the material has certain surface positive charges; and plasma grafting modification is carried out to generate a large number of active free radicals on the surface of the material, covalent reaction with sodium alginate is carried out, finally, a layer-by-layer self-assembly process is realized under the driving of electrostatic force between a polyanion compound sodium alginate and a polycation compound chitosan, and therefore,a stable layered composite structure is formed on the surface of the material. By chemically modifying the surface of polyurethane, the obtained plasma modified iron and manganese ion-sodium alginate-chitosan layer-by-layer self-assembly material is good in biocompatibility, high in chemical stability, safe, non-toxic, simple to operate, low in cost and easy to obtain. By using the method, the microorganism immobilization efficiency can be effectively improved.
